'Hélène Carrère d'Encausse' rose Description

Origin:
Bred by Jean-Lin Lebrun (France, 2010).
Class:
Shrub.  
Bloom:
White, light yellow undertones.  Mild fragrance.  Semi-double to double, in small clusters bloom form.  Blooms in flushes throughout the season.  
Habit:
Upright.  

Height: 2' to 32" (60 to 80cm).  Width: up to 2' (up to 60cm).
Growing:
Can be used for beds and borders or garden.  Disease susceptibility: very disease resistant.
